/** @odoo-module **/
import { CheckBox } from "@web/core/checkbox/checkbox";
import { hotkeyService } from "@web/core/hotkeys/hotkey_service";
import { translatedTerms } from "@web/core/l10n/translation";
import { registry } from "@web/core/registry";
import { makeTestEnv } from "@web/../tests/helpers/mock_env";
import { makeFakeLocalizationService } from "@web/../tests/helpers/mock_services";
import {
click,
getFixture,
patchWithCleanup,
mount,
triggerEvent,
triggerHotkey,
nextTick,
} from "@web/../tests/helpers/utils";
import { Component, useState, xml } from "@odoo/owl";
const serviceRegistry = registry.category("services");
let target;
QUnit.module("Components", (hooks) => {
hooks.beforeEach(async () => {
target = getFixture();
serviceRegistry.add("hotkey", hotkeyService);
});
QUnit.module("CheckBox");
QUnit.test("can be rendered", async (assert) => {
const env = await makeTestEnv();
await mount(CheckBox, target, { env, props: {} });
assert.containsOnce(target, '.o-checkbox input[type="checkbox"]');
});
QUnit.test("has a slot for translatable text", async (assert) => {
patchWithCleanup(translatedTerms, { ragabadabadaba: "rugubudubudubu" });
serviceRegistry.add("localization", makeFakeLocalizationService());
const env = await makeTestEnv();
class Parent extends Component {}
Parent.template = xml`<CheckBox>ragabadabadaba</CheckBox>`;
Parent.components = { CheckBox };
await mount(Parent, target, { env });
assert.containsOnce(target, "div.form-check");
assert.strictEqual(target.querySelector("div.form-check").textContent, "rugubudubudubu");
});
QUnit.test("call onChange prop when some change occurs", async (assert) => {
const env = await makeTestEnv();
let value = false;
class Parent extends Component {
onChange(checked) {
value = checked;
}
}
Parent.template = xml`<CheckBox onChange="onChange"/>`;
Parent.components = { CheckBox };
await mount(Parent, target, { env });
assert.containsOnce(target, ".o-checkbox input");
await click(target.querySelector("input"));
assert.strictEqual(value, true);
await click(target.querySelector("input"));
assert.strictEqual(value, false);
});
QUnit.test("does not call onChange prop when disabled", async (assert) => {
const env = await makeTestEnv();
let onChangeCalled = false;
class Parent extends Component {
onChange(checked) {
onChangeCalled = true;
}
}
Parent.template = xml`<CheckBox onChange="onChange" disabled="true"/>`;
Parent.components = { CheckBox };
await mount(Parent, target, { env });
assert.containsOnce(target, ".o-checkbox input");
await click(target.querySelector("input"));
assert.strictEqual(onChangeCalled, false);
});
QUnit.test("can toggle value by pressing ENTER", async (assert) => {
const env = await makeTestEnv();
class Parent extends Component {
setup() {
this.state = useState({ value: false });
}
onChange(checked) {
this.state.value = checked;
}
}
Parent.template = xml`<CheckBox onChange.bind="onChange" value="state.value"/>`;
Parent.components = { CheckBox };
await mount(Parent, target, { env });
assert.containsOnce(target, ".o-checkbox input");
assert.notOk(target.querySelector(".o-checkbox input").checked);
await triggerEvent(target, ".o-checkbox input", "keydown", { key: "Enter" });
assert.ok(target.querySelector(".o-checkbox input").checked);
await triggerEvent(target, ".o-checkbox input", "keydown", { key: "Enter" });
assert.notOk(target.querySelector(".o-checkbox input").checked);
});
QUnit.test("toggling through multiple ways", async (assert) => {
const env = await makeTestEnv();
class Parent extends Component {
setup() {
this.state = useState({ value: false });
}
onChange(checked) {
this.state.value = checked;
assert.step(`${checked}`);
}
}
Parent.template = xml`<CheckBox onChange.bind="onChange" value="state.value"/>`;
Parent.components = { CheckBox };
await mount(Parent, target, { env });
assert.containsOnce(target, ".o-checkbox input");
assert.notOk(target.querySelector(".o-checkbox input").checked);
// Click on div
assert.verifySteps([]);
await click(target, ".o-checkbox");
assert.ok(target.querySelector(".o-checkbox input").checked);
assert.verifySteps(["true"]);
// Click on label
assert.verifySteps([]);
await click(target, ".o-checkbox > .form-check-label", true);
assert.notOk(target.querySelector(".o-checkbox input").checked);
assert.verifySteps(["false"]);
// Click on input (only possible programmatically)
assert.verifySteps([]);
await click(target, ".o-checkbox input");
assert.ok(target.querySelector(".o-checkbox input").checked);
assert.verifySteps(["true"]);
// When somehow applying focus on label, the focus receives it
// (this is the default behavior from the label)
target.querySelector(".o-checkbox > .form-check-label").focus();
await nextTick();
assert.strictEqual(document.activeElement, target.querySelector(".o-checkbox input"));
// Press Enter when focus is on input
assert.verifySteps([]);
triggerHotkey("Enter");
await nextTick();
assert.notOk(target.querySelector(".o-checkbox input").checked);
assert.verifySteps(["false"]);
// Pressing Space when focus is on the input is a standard behavior
// So we simulate it and verify that it will have its standard behavior.
assert.strictEqual(document.activeElement, target.querySelector(".o-checkbox input"));
const event = await triggerEvent(document.activeElement, null, "keydown", { key: "Space" });
assert.ok(!event.defaultPrevented);
target.querySelector(".o-checkbox input").checked = true;
assert.verifySteps([]);
await triggerEvent(target, ".o-checkbox input", "change");
assert.ok(target.querySelector(".o-checkbox input").checked);
assert.verifySteps(["true"]);
});
});
